Lambda Probe Oxygen Sensors DOX-0240 8946512620 89465-12620 For 8946505090 2002-2009 TOYOTA COROLLA VERSO 1.6L 1.8L

Lambda Probe Oxygen Sensors DOX-0240 8946512620 89465-12620 For 8946505090 2002-2009 TOYOTA COROLLA VERSO 1.6L 1.8L
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005005254201217
$11.15
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ed